关于.NET, HTML的五个问题


Posted in 面试题 onAugust 29, 2012
1. Web服务器控件和Windows控件的执行有何不同?
【解答】一般来说,大部分Web服务器控件和Windows控件的功能和使用都很相似,但是二者在内部实现上却有着本质的区别。Windows控件的属性、方法、事件等都是在本机上执行的,而Web服务器控件则全部是在服务器端执行的。

2. 利用HiddenField控件是否可用来存储保密数据?为什么?
【解答】HiddenField控件,即隐藏输入框的服务器控件,可以用于存储非显示的值。在Web应用程序中,可以使用HiddenField控件来存储Web窗体页的状态值。但是,在Web应用程序运行期间,查看源代码会发现该控件是以的形式呈现给客户端浏览器的,其隐藏值value是用户可见的,所以它不适用于存储需要保密数据。

3. SqlDataSource组件的作用是什么?
【解答】SqlDataSource组件是一种数据源控件,它可以连接到任何ADO.NET支持的数据源(如SQL Server、Oracle等),从中检索数据,并使得其他控件(如GridView等控件)可以绑定到数据源。使用SqlDataSource组件访问数据,只需要提供用于连接到数据库的连接字符串,并定义访问数据的SQL语句或存储过程。在运行时,SqlDataSource组件会自动打开与数据库的连接,执行SQL语句或存储过程,完成数据访问后自动关闭连接。

4. 采用GridView控件、DataList控件、DetailsView控件来显示数据各有何特点?
【解答】GridView控件、DataList控件、DetailsView控件都可以利用SqlDataSource控件绑定SQL数据源自动显示数据。就显示数据的能力来说,GridView控件、DataList控件一次可以显示数据表中的多条记录,而DetailsView控件每次只能显示数据表中的一条记录;就操作数据的能力来说,GridView控件、DetailsView控件都可以自动利用SqlDataSource控件的数据操作命令来编辑所显示的数据,而DataList控件则需要编写自身的相应事件才可以完成编辑数据的操作。

5. 使用站点地图进行导航时,SiteMapPath控件与Menu控件有何不同?
【解答】利用站点地图Web.sitemap进行网站导航时,SiteMapPath控件仅能显示用于在站点地图中列出的页面中显示导航路径,而Menu控件即使使用在站点地图中没有列出的页面中,也可以生成菜单,显示所有的导航数据。

Tags in this post...

面试题 相关文章推荐
Java TransactionAPI (JTA) 主要包含几部分
Dec 07 面试题
新东网科技Java笔试题
Jul 13 面试题
什么是数组名
May 10 面试题
经典c++面试题四
May 14 面试题
介绍一下游标
Jan 10 面试题
几道数据库的面试题或笔试题
May 31 面试题
new修饰符是起什么作用
Jun 28 面试题
软件测试常见笔试题
Feb 04 面试题
GC是什么?为什么要有GC?
Dec 08 面试题
高级Java程序员面试要点
Aug 02 面试题
在DELPHI中调用存储过程和使用内嵌SQL哪种方式更好
Nov 22 面试题
介绍一下SOA和SOA的基本特征
Feb 24 面试题
广州一家公司的.NET面试题
Jun 11 #面试题
.NET是怎么支持多种语言的
Feb 24 #面试题
.NET初级开发工程师面试题
Apr 18 #面试题
广州盈通面试题
Dec 05 #面试题
结构和类有什么异同
Jul 16 #面试题
托管代码(Managed Code)和非托管代码(Unmanaged Code)有什么区别
Sep 29 #面试题
.NET初级开发工程师面试题(包括Javascript)
Aug 22 #面试题
You might like
yii的CURD操作实例详解
2014/12/04 PHP
完整删除ecshop中获取店铺信息的API
2014/12/24 PHP
php readfile下载大文件失败的解决方法
2017/05/22 PHP
php JWT在web端中的使用方法教程
2018/09/06 PHP
php写入txt乱码的解决方法
2019/09/17 PHP
Javascript----文件操作
2007/01/18 Javascript
JavaScript入门教程(8) Location地址对象
2009/01/31 Javascript
一款Jquery 分页插件的改造方法(服务器端分页)
2011/07/11 Javascript
Extjs中RowExpander控件的默认展开问题示例探讨
2014/01/24 Javascript
jQuery修改li下的样式以及li下的img的src的值的方法
2014/11/02 Javascript
jQuery内部原理和实现方式浅析
2015/02/03 Javascript
jQuery实现表格行上下移动和置顶效果
2015/06/05 Javascript
异步JavaScript编程中的Promise使用方法
2015/07/28 Javascript
Google 地图控件集详解及实例代码
2016/08/06 Javascript
gulp-uglify 与gulp.watch()配合使用时报错(重复压缩问题)
2016/08/24 Javascript
jQuery与js实现颜色渐变的方法
2016/12/30 Javascript
JavaScript中Math对象的方法介绍
2017/01/05 Javascript
微信小程序实现聊天对话(文本、图片)功能
2018/07/06 Javascript
layui实现table加载的示例代码
2018/08/14 Javascript
解决echarts vue数据更新,视图不更新问题(echarts嵌在vue弹框中)
2020/07/20 Javascript
[49:54]Ti4 循环赛第三日 LGD vs Titan
2014/07/12 DOTA
[00:43]DOTA2小紫本全民票选福利PA至宝全方位展示
2014/11/25 DOTA
Python中删除文件的程序代码
2011/03/13 Python
Python中使用gzip模块压缩文件的简单教程
2015/04/08 Python
python中zip和unzip数据的方法
2015/05/27 Python
深入理解Python中的 __new__ 和 __init__及区别介绍
2018/09/17 Python
python多进程使用及线程池的使用方法代码详解
2018/10/24 Python
美国校园市场:OCM
2017/06/08 全球购物
Sarenza德国:法国最大的时尚鞋和包包网上商店
2019/06/08 全球购物
如何用JQuery进行表单验证
2013/05/29 面试题
公司成本主管岗位责任制
2014/02/21 职场文书
经理任命书模板
2014/06/06 职场文书
2014年小班保育员工作总结
2014/12/23 职场文书
高三英语教学反思
2016/03/03 职场文书
导游词之铁岭象牙山
2019/12/06 职场文书
html解决浏览器记住密码输入框的问题
2023/05/07 HTML / CSS